  16. # We are using a recursive build, so we need to do a little thinking
  17. # to get the ordering right.
  18. #
  19. # Most importantly: sub-Makefiles should only ever modify files in
  20. # their own directory. If in some directory we have a dependency on
  21. # a file in another dir (which doesn't happen often, but it's often
  22. # unavoidable when linking the built-in.o targets which finally
  23. # turn into vmlinux), we will call a sub make in that other dir, and
  24. # after that we are sure that everything which is in that other dir
  25. # is now up to date.
  26. #
  27. # The only cases where we need to modify files which have global
  28. # effects are thus separated out and done before the recursive
  29. # descending is started. They are now explicitly listed as the
  30. # prepare rule.

  69. # kbuild supports saving output files in a separate directory.
  70. # To locate output files in a separate directory two syntaxes are supported.
  71. # In both cases the working directory must be the root of the kernel src.
  72. # 1) O=
  73. # Use "make O=dir/to/store/output/files/"
  74. #
  75. # 2) Set KBUILD_OUTPUT
  76. # Set the environment variable KBUILD_OUTPUT to point to the directory
  77. # where the output files shall be placed.
  78. # export KBUILD_OUTPUT=dir/to/store/output/files/
  79. # make
  80. #
  81. # The O= assignment takes precedence over the KBUILD_OUTPUT environment
  82. # variable.

  145. # Cross compiling and selecting different set of gcc/bin-utils
  146. # ---------------------------------------------------------------------------
  147. #
  148. # When performing cross compilation for other architectures ARCH shall be set
  149. # to the target architecture. (See arch/* for the possibilities).
  150. # ARCH can be set during invocation of make:
  151. # make ARCH=ia64
  152. # Another way is to have ARCH set in the environment.
  153. # The default ARCH is the host where make is executed.
  154. # CROSS_COMPILE specify the prefix used for all executables used
  155. # during compilation. Only gcc and related bin-utils executables
  156. # are prefixed with $(CROSS_COMPILE).
  157. # CROSS_COMPILE can be set on the command line
  158. # make CROSS_COMPILE=ia64-linux-
  159. # Alternatively CROSS_COMPILE can be set in the environment.
  160. # Default value for CROSS_COMPILE is not to prefix executables
  161. # Note: Some architectures assign CROSS_COMPILE in their arch/*/Makefile

  215. # Beautify output
  216. # ---------------------------------------------------------------------------
  217. #
  218. # Normally, we echo the whole command before executing it. By making
  219. # that echo $($(quiet)$(cmd)), we now have the possibility to set
  220. # $(quiet) to choose other forms of output instead, e.g.
  221. #
  222. # quiet_cmd_cc_o_c = Compiling $(RELDIR)/$@
  223. # cmd_cc_o_c = $(CC) $(c_flags) -c -o $@ $<
  224. #
  225. # If $(quiet) is empty, the whole command will be printed.
  226. # If it is set to "quiet_", only the short version will be printed.
  227. # If it is set to "silent_", nothing will be printed at all, since
  228. # the variable $(silent_cmd_cc_o_c) doesn't exist.
  229. #
  230. # A simple variant is to prefix commands with $(Q) - that's useful
  231. # for commands that shall be hidden in non-verbose mode.
  232. #
  233. # $(Q)ln $@ :<
  234. #
  235. # If KBUILD_VERBOSE equals 0 then the above command will be hidden.
  236. # If KBUILD_VERBOSE equals 1 then the above command is displayed.

  541. # Build vmlinux
  542. # ---------------------------------------------------------------------------
  543. # vmlinux is built from the objects selected by $(vmlinux-init) and
  544. # $(vmlinux-main). Most are built-in.o files from top-level directories
  545. # in the kernel tree, others are specified in arch/$(ARCH)/Makefile.
  546. # Ordering when linking is important, and $(vmlinux-init) must be first.
  547. #
  548. # vmlinux
  549. # ^
  550. # |
  551. # +-< $(vmlinux-init)
  552. # | +--< init/version.o + more
  553. # |
  554. # +--< $(vmlinux-main)
  555. # | +--< driver/built-in.o mm/built-in.o + more
  556. # |
  557. # +-< kallsyms.o (see description in CONFIG_KALLSYMS section)
  558. #
  559. # vmlinux version (uname -v) cannot be updated during normal
  560. # descending-into-subdirs phase since we do not yet know if we need to
  561. # update vmlinux.
  562. # Therefore this step is delayed until just before final link of vmlinux -
  563. # except in the kallsyms case where it is done just before adding the
  564. # symbols to the kernel.

  612. ifdef CONFIG_KALLSYMS
  613. # Generate section listing all symbols and add it into vmlinux $(kallsyms.o)
  614. # It's a three stage process:
  615. # o .tmp_vmlinux1 has all symbols and sections, but __kallsyms is
  616. # empty
  617. # Running kallsyms on that gives us .tmp_kallsyms1.o with
  618. # the right size - vmlinux version (uname -v) is updated during this step
  619. # o .tmp_vmlinux2 now has a __kallsyms section of the right size,
  620. # but due to the added section, some addresses have shifted.
  621. # From here, we generate a correct .tmp_kallsyms2.o
  622. # o The correct .tmp_kallsyms2.o is linked into the final vmlinux.
  623. # o Verify that the System.map from vmlinux matches the map from
  624. # .tmp_vmlinux2, just in case we did not generate kallsyms correctly.
  625. # o If CONFIG_KALLSYMS_EXTRA_PASS is set, do an extra pass using
  626. # .tmp_vmlinux3 and .tmp_kallsyms3.o. This is only meant as a
  627. # temporary bypass to allow the kernel to be built while the
  628. # maintainers work out what went wrong with kallsyms.

  722. # Build the kernel release string
  723. #
  724. # The KERNELRELEASE value built here is stored in the file
  725. # include/config/kernel.release, and is used when executing several
  726. # make targets, such as "make install" or "make modules_install."
  727. #
  728. # The eventual kernel release string consists of the following fields,
  729. # shown in a hierarchical format to show how smaller parts are concatenated
  730. # to form the larger and final value, with values coming from places like
  731. # the Makefile, kernel config options, make command line options and/or
  732. # SCM tag information.
  733. #
  734. # $(KERNELVERSION)
  735. # $(VERSION) eg, 2
  736. # $(PATCHLEVEL) eg, 6
  737. # $(SUBLEVEL) eg, 18
  738. # $(EXTRAVERSION) eg, -rc6
  739. # $(localver-full)
  740. # $(localver)
  741. # localversion* (files without backups, containing '~')
  742. # $(CONFIG_LOCALVERSION) (from kernel config setting)
  743. # $(localver-auto) (only if CONFIG_LOCALVERSION_AUTO is set)
  744. # ./scripts/setlocalversion (SCM tag, if one exists)
  745. # $(LOCALVERSION) (from make command line if provided)
  746. #
  747. # Note how the final $(localver-auto) string is included *only* if the
  748. # kernel config option CONFIG_LOCALVERSION_AUTO is selected. Also, at the
  749. # moment, only git is supported but other SCMs can edit the script
  750. # scripts/setlocalversion and add the appropriate checks as needed.

  974. # Cleaning is done on three levels.
  975. # make clean Delete most generated files
  976. # Leave enough to build external modules
  977. # make mrproper Delete the current configuration, and all generated files
  978. # make distclean Remove editor backup files, patch leftover files and the like
